AceShowbiz - Ariana Grande celebrated the eighth anniversary of signing her first-ever record deal, and thanked her label for believing in her.

The 26-year-old signed with Republic Records back in 2011, and released her debut album "Yours Truly" two years later, and "My Everything" in 2014. She took a four-year break and finally gave fans her long-awaited third album "Sweetener", and followed it up with "Thank U, Next" earlier this year.

"Signed to @RepublicRecords eight years ago today and released my debut album six years ago ..." Grande posted on Twitter on Saturday, August 10.

"Thankful for my republic family and deeply proud of every project we've released together. music is the most special thing in the world. thank u for believing in me and my voice," she gushed.

Republic, a branch of Universal Music Group, spotted the "God is a Woman" hitmaker's tweet and replied with some sweet words of their own for the singer.

"So honored to be family!" the label's Twitter account posted. "We couldn't be more proud of your growth & dedication. All the love in the worldddddd."
